ED-GUN R-5M .22 CALIBER , tuning for heavy ammo ,

OK got gun and adjusted stock regulator to 145 bar and I got 44 FPE , I am trying to shoot NOE 30 gr and MP 36 grain Slugs , So not enough power for these yet

I got a HUMA Regulator in mail today and installed it . I set it to 140 bar first , and I checked speeds or 3 tyoes of ammo , I chronographed the NOE 30 gr , the MP slug 36 gr and JSB 33.95 gr .,I sized a few to start to see groups , here is what I found so far

MP slug 36grains 820 fps and 55 FPE , NOE 30 grain 900 FPS 55 fpe , JSB 33.95 grain pellet 855fps 54FPE

I sized first group to .216 first grouped horrible at 75 yards with NOE and MP slugs like 4 to 5 inch group

I then resized NOE slugs to .217 and they shot 905 fps and I shot a group of JSB 33.95 grain pellets at 855 FPS and groups were 1.2 and 1.4 inches , the ran out of daylight to be continued , maybe raise reg to 145 or 150 and try .21755 hmmm

notice between both targets , the difference is .001 in diameter proper size means so much for slugs , I did think the .216 would shoot ok as I pushehed them threw rifling and I did see it marking up slugs , I guess not enough to spin properly hmm

I have a .25 Huma in a .22 for the larger plenum area the reg max's out at 170 bar if I remember this is in a Hatsan BT65 .22 cal , there is a relationship between weight BC and twist rate if you can push them at xxx fps but cant spin them fast enough for stabilisation for that xxx you loose .

This is the same in centre fire rifles 55 grn Vmax , Hornady BT 55 grn , 52 SMK all super accurate at 3600 fps ish with a 1/14 twist barrel , then 53 grn Amax or Vmax much better BC if I remember right you need a faster twist for same fps , more revolutions for stability at same speed .
 
HI I had a great day shooting I set regulator to 155 bar as huma recommended , and I adjusted hammer spring to max with chronograph then backed off 10 fps just so it was not totally maxed , Ok here is my results

MP 36 gr slug 870 fps 61f pe unsized unsorted

NOE 30 gr 920fps 58 fpe unsized unsorted

JSB 33.95 gr 61FPE unsorted

Great! Info! I just got the same gun and plan on shoot slug also. I've been messing with bullet stability calculators for my R5M. It appears that around 28 grains or .4" in length , the slug will become a only marginal stable in flight with this twist rate. I'm going to be focusing on medium weight slugs.
